Re: Flight Instructors Annual Flight Time?
I did just under 700 hours my first year instructing (~680 h). That was on the East Coast with terrible weather. I also did close to the same amount of ground instruction (maybe around ~600 h).
I don't know what the going rate is at other schools (I hear some horror stories, but I don't know how common they are), but the school I work with now pays Class 4's $38/h plus some small increments depending on what other qualifications/experience they have. That increases to $60/h for Class 1's plus the same increments.

Re: Flight Instructors Annual Flight Time?
You should be in the mid 30's give or take per billable hour depending on location.
500-1000 hours per year is a good range. Depends how much you want to work and the weather in the winter.
